Here are a few tips to ensure your school recycling program is a success.
- Get Input. Plan and design your recycling program with input from students, teachers and your facilities management team.
- Communicate: Schedule a “kick off” event to communicate your recycling program to everyone.
- Location is Key: Place recycle bins in key locations around the school – indoors and outdoors.\
- Consistency: Be sure all your bins can collect all materials in your recycling program, including waste.
- Signs: Place easy to read signs on the bins so materials go in the right bins.
- Lids: Use lids to help identify what goes in the bins.
- Clarity: Lids and signs will help reduce mixing recyclables and trash.
- Remove Garbage Only Bins: Don’t use separate trash containers or people will put recyclables in them.
- Provide Updates: Provide updates and ongoing education of the program.
- Get Feedback: Learn how the program is doing through lunch and learns or surveys to determine what works for everyone.
